Hello Astro 项目常见问题解决方案
1. 项目基础介绍和主要编程语言
Hello Astro 是一个多功能的开源项目,用于构建网站和博客。它采用 TypeScript 作为主要编程语言,同时使用了 TailwindCSS 和 AlpineJS 技术栈。该项目支持 Markdown 和 MDX 格式的页面和博客文章,适合构建企业网站、营销站点、博客、文档站点、个人作品集以及支持图片库的站点。
2. 新手常见问题及解决步骤
问题一:如何开始本地开发?
问题描述: 新手用户在克隆项目后,不知道如何开始本地开发。
解决步骤:
- 首先,确保你已经安装了 Node.js 和 npm(或 yarn)。
- 克隆项目到本地:
git clone https://github.com/hellotham/hello-astro.git
- 进入项目目录:
cd hello-astro
- 安装项目依赖:
或者npm install
yarn install
- 启动本地开发服务器:
或者npm run dev
yarn run dev
- 打开浏览器,访问
http://localhost:3000
查看项目。
问题二:如何添加新页面?
问题描述: 用户希望在博客中添加新页面,但不知道如何操作。
解决步骤:
- 在
src/pages
目录下创建新的 Markdown 或 MDX 文件,例如new-page.md
。 - 在文件中添加必要的 YAML 前置信息,如标题、描述等。
- 编写页面内容,并保存文件。
- 重新启动本地开发服务器以查看新页面。
问题三:如何配置 TailwindCSS?
问题描述: 用户想要自定义 TailwindCSS 的配置,但不知道如何进行。
解决步骤:
- 在项目根目录下,找到
tailwind.config.cjs
文件。 - 根据官方文档,修改
tailwind.config.cjs
文件中的配置项,以满足自定义需求。 - 保存文件,并重新启动本地开发服务器以应用更改。
以上是新手在使用 Hello Astro 项目时可能遇到的一些常见问题及解决步骤。希望这些信息能够帮助您更好地使用和开发这个项目。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考